October 24, 2020, New York, USA: Early voting in New York started October 24 and will go on till November 1st at Robert Wagner Middle School, in Manhattan, New York, there is a long line of people waiting for a long time before the opening of the polling station at 10am. The double long line of people started at East 75 street with 3rd Avenue and goes all around till 2nd Avenue and East 76 and back to the Polling center. People were complaining of the long waiting time and some of them were reading books, newspapers while others brought their portable folding chairs as they wait. Inside the polling center, people were given hand sanitizers, asked to follow the sign on the ground to keep 6 feet distance from each other. Election volunteers are shielded with glass as they attend to voters. The early voting is From 10am to 4pm on weekends, 7 am to 3pm on Monday and Friday and from 12 to 8pm on Tuesday, Wednesday and Thursday. There are some a Police officers at the station to provide law and order.
